Hi Mike,
Means just what it says - the uid field in your /etc/passwd file (or in your
nis database) for the user walliske
is DIFFERENT than the uid field  in your /usr/local/samba/private/smbpasswd
file entry for user walliske.
do a grep walliske /usr/local/samba/private/smbpasswd
and a grep walliske /etc/passwd  (or ypcat passwd|grep walliske)  and make
the uid fields in both files
match.

I am getting this error in the client log file.  Why. 
  Error : UNIX and SMB uids in password files do not match for user
'walliske'! 
[2002/03/22 07:03:48, 0] smbd/password.c:(513) 
I am running samba on HP-UX 11.00 and the client is a standalone w2k laptop.

Here is a copy of my smb.config file 
  [global] 
           workgroup = UNIX 
           netbios name = AMBER 
           security = SERVER 
           encrypt passwords = Yes 
           map to guest = Bad Password 
           username map = /etc/opt/samba/user.map 
           log file = /usr/local/samba/log.%m 
           preferred master = Yes 
           domain master = Yes 

   [data] 
           path = /data 
           writeable = Yes 

   [printers] 
           path = /tmp/spool 
           printable = Yes 
I have created a map file and used smbpasswd to change users password to
match unix and w2k.
